Description

Azospirillum argentinense is a Gram-positive, rod-shaped bacterium primarily found in the rhizosphere of various plants, as well as in soil environments. This microaerophilic organism thrives in conditions with limited oxygen availability, which is characteristic of its ecological niche associated with plant roots. Azospirillum argentinense is particularly noted for its role in plant growth promotion, as it is capable of forming beneficial associations with various plant species. By colonizing the rhizosphere, this bacterium can enhance nutrient availability and uptake, contributing to overall plant health and productivity. The microaerophilic nature of A. argentinense suggests that it has adapted to exploit specific microenvironments within the soil that provide optimal oxygen levels conducive to its metabolic processes. The unique ecological insight into Azospirillum argentinense lies in its potential contribution to sustainable agriculture. By fostering beneficial plant-microbe interactions, this bacterium may play a significant role in enhancing soil fertility and promoting plant growth, which aligns with modern agricultural practices aimed at reducing chemical inputs and improving crop resilience.
